Dans ce cours d'une heure, basé sur un projet, vous apprendrez à créer un Loadbalancer avec Haproxy dans Docker. A la fin de ce projet guidé, vous serez en mesure de: - Configurer HaProxy - Déployer HaProxy et mettre en oeuvre le Loadbalancer dans Docker - Configurer la répartition de charge sur plusieurs instances de serveur ou d'application avec HaProxy - Accéder aux journaux et statistiques de HaProxy dans une interface graphique - Protéger l'accès à l'interface graphique des statistiques de HaProxy avec un mot de passe Ce projet guidé est recommandé à toute personne souhaitant implémenter un répartiteur de charge pour plusieurs instances d'application ou serveur dans Docker.
